CDCR hosts two One Stop recruiting events

CDCR one stop event information banner.

CDCR is hosting two One Stop workshops in September for those considering correctional officer careers. Pre-registration is required to attend.

The first is Friday, Sept. 16, 2022, 9 a.m., at San Quentin State Prison.

The second is in Fairfield on Saturday, Sept. 17, 2022, at 9 a.m.

The CDCR One Stop Event is an in-person information session where you can apply and take the written test all in one stop. ‍‍‍‍

All in one day:

  • Recruitment presentation
  • Q&A sessions
  • Apply onsite
  • Take the written exam

Reduce your timeline and start a career with CDCR.‍

Interested Correctional Officer applicants can apply online at JoinCDCR.com.
